Cathie Wood pitches upside of disappointing returns of flagship investment fund
Cathie Wood’s Ark Investment Management has a new pitch to investors who might be concerned by the asset manager’s huge losses owing to rising interest rates — think of the tax write-offs. Wood’s flagship investment product — the $6.3bn ARK Innovation exchange traded fund, known as ARKK — is down more than 25 per cent over the past three months, according to Morningstar.
Several big holdings for ARKK, such as Zoom and Block, have been down this year, offsetting stronger performance by the likes of Coinbase and Roku. While perennial top holding Tesla is up nearly 100 per cent year to date, its stock is still well below its highs of late 2021 and early 2022. Wood noted on Thursday’s webinar that she thought the potential to save on taxes offered by her company’s ETFs was underappreciated.
